6-7 small corn or flour tortilla shells
8-10 battered fish fillets, fully cooked (I used gordon's)
1 c. shredded cabbage
pico de gallo (see below) or Joe's salsa
sauce (see below)
Cotija or feta cheese (to taste)
cilantro (to taste)
Put a piece of fish in each tortilla shell, top with
cabbage, sauce, pico, feta, and fresh cilantro.
Sauce:
1/2 c. mayo
1/2 c. sour cream
1/2 bunch cilantro, chopped
2 tsp. diced jalapeno
1/2 tsp. cumin
1 tsp. cayenne
1 Tbsp. lime juice
salt & pepper to taste
For sauce: Mix all ingredients together
until well blended.
Pico:
2 plum tomatoes, diced
2 Tbsp. FRESH cilantro, chopped
1 avocado, diced
dash salt
dash pepper
1 Tbsp. lime juice
For pico: Toss all ingredients together and let sit in the fridge for about 30 minutes.
